How long does it take to replace an alternator on a 2001 ford Taurus 3.0 dohc?

1-3 hours, if you do it yourself make sure to disconnect the battery first
The labor guide calls for 2.4 hours. If you decide to do it yourself disconnect your battery first, get a service manual and draw a picture of your serpentine belt routing if your under hood sticker is gone

Any alternator is bolted on with 2-4 bolds has a few wires out the back and is attached to the serpentine belt (or water pump belt on some models)
I can do the alternator on my f-250 460ci in about 10m but stuff is a little easier to reach
it's not a difficult thing to do
Disconnect the battery
take the serpentine belt of
unbolt the alternator disconnect the wires on the back
attach wires to new alternator bolt into place replace serpentine belt reattached battery
done
